James Hough (born August 4, 1956 in Lynwood, California) is a former professional American football player. Hough, an offensive lineman, played nine seasons in the National Football League for the Minnesota Vikings. He played college football for Utah State University.

He now coaches 10th grade football for the Chaska Hawks in Chaska, Minnesota [ [http://www.district112.org/chs/athletics/footballb/Coaches.htm Chaska Hawks Football ] ] .
